Art for the People

We wanted to find ways for Coventry people to have a say in how our city views, values and uses arts, culture and creativity, so we called (what we think is) the UK’s first Citizens’ Assembly on Arts and Culture.

apply for a residency at the nest

Nest Residencies are designed by artists, for artists*. They are simple, adaptable and flexible, and aim to focus on the early stages of idea or project development through supporting time to play, experiment, dream and meander.

About Talking Birds

We are a Coventry-based company of artists known for our gently provocative projects which explore, and seek to illuminate, the profound and complex relationships between people and place. We’re big on access, human connection, social and ecological responsibility, and on nurturing the next generation of artists and theatre makers, particularly in Coventry.
